About Summer Walker

Summer Walker's ascent to R&B stardom has been nothing short of captivating, a testament to raw talent and unwavering authenticity. Emerging from Atlanta, her journey wasn't paved with overnight fame, but rather a steady build of genuine connection with her audience. Her breakthrough moment arrived with the release of her 2019 debut album, "Over It." This project, deeply personal and sonically rich, resonated with millions, hitting number two on the Billboard 200 and solidifying her place as a leading voice in contemporary R&B.

Walker's musical style is characterized by its candid lyricism, often exploring themes of love, heartbreak, relationships, and self-discovery with unflinching honesty. Her vocal delivery is smooth, often laced with a vulnerable rasp that adds an extra layer of emotional depth. Over the course of her career, she’s demonstrated an evolution, seamlessly blending soulful melodies with modern production, creating a sound that feels both timeless and relevant. Notable albums like "Over It" and its follow-up, "Still Over It," have been critically acclaimed and commercially successful, earning her multiple Grammy nominations and a fervent fanbase.

Barclays Center: The Perfect Setting

Nestled in the heart of Brooklyn, the Barclays Center stands as a beacon of contemporary entertainment, making it the absolutely ideal venue for an artist like Summer Walker. Opened in 2012, this multi-purpose arena is renowned for its striking octagonal design, a distinctive architectural feature that not only makes it a landmark but also contributes to its impressive acoustics. With a seating capacity that can reach up to 19,000 for concerts, it offers an intimate yet grand atmosphere, perfect for immersing oneself in Walker's soulful melodies.

The arena's state-of-the-art sound system and thoughtful seating arrangements ensure that whether you're in the front row or further back, you're treated to an exceptional audio-visual experience. Its prime location in Downtown Brooklyn, easily accessible by numerous subway lines and a short walk from Prospect Park, places it at the nexus of the borough's vibrant cultural scene. Barclays Center has hosted a dazzling array of musical titans, from Beyoncé and Jay-Z to Drake and The Rolling Stones, proving its capability to deliver unforgettable live music experiences. Getting to Barclays Center: Complete Transport Guide

Navigating your way to the Barclays Center for Summer Walker’s performance is a breeze, thanks to Brooklyn's excellent public transportation network. For those arriving by train, the closest major hub is Atlantic Terminal, which is a short walk from the arena. Here, you'll find lines like the Long Island Rail Road (LIRR) connecting you from various parts of Long Island and New York City. Travel times will vary significantly depending on your starting point.

The New York City Subway is your most direct route. Several stations are within easy walking distance. The Atlantic Av-Barclays Ctr station is directly beneath the center and is served by the 2, 3, 4, 5, B, D, N, Q, and R lines, offering unparalleled connectivity. The Union St station (D, N, R) and Pacific St station (D, N, R) are also just a few blocks away, typically a 5-10 minute walk.

Several bus routes stop near Barclays Center, including the B25, B26, B37, B38, B41, B45, B52, B57, and B67. These provide excellent local connections throughout Brooklyn and beyond. If you’re driving, parking in the immediate vicinity of Barclays Center is available in a dedicated on-site garage, but it is notoriously limited and expensive. Street parking is highly restricted in this busy urban area, so relying on public transport is strongly advised. For those staying nearby or within Brooklyn, walking to Barclays Center can be a pleasant option, especially from neighborhoods like Fort Greene or Prospect Heights.

We recommend arriving early, at least 1.5 to 2 hours before the show’s start time, to allow ample time for security checks, finding your seats, and soaking in the pre-show atmosphere. Dedicated disabled access is available at Barclays Center, with accessible entrances and seating throughout the venue. Public transport options like accessible subway stations and bus routes are also available; it’s advisable to check the MTA’s accessibility information beforehand.

Frequently Asked Questions

What time does Summer Walker typically take the stage? Doors for Barclays Center events usually open 1.5 to 2 hours before the scheduled start time. If there are opening acts, they typically perform for about 30-45 minutes each, with a break before the headliner. Summer Walker, as the main act, usually takes the stage between 9:00 PM and 9:30 PM, depending on the show's overall schedule. The concert typically concludes around 11:00 PM to 11:30 PM.

What songs will Summer Walker play? Summer Walker's setlists are a carefully curated blend of her biggest hits and fan-favorite deep cuts. Expect to hear anthems like "Girls Need Love (Remix)," "Playing Games," "Body," and tracks from "Still Over It." She often incorporates moments of improvisation and may sprinkle in a cover or a less-frequently performed gem. Her setlist aims to take you on an emotional journey, so be prepared for a mix of bangers and introspective ballads.

How long is the concert? The total concert duration, including any opening acts and intermissions, usually runs for approximately 2.5 to 3 hours. Summer Walker's performance itself typically lasts around 1.5 to 2 hours.

Will there be an opening act? While not always announced far in advance, Summer Walker's tours often feature talented emerging R&B artists as opening acts. These selections are usually artists who align with her soulful aesthetic. We will update with any official announcements regarding support acts closer to the date.

What are age restrictions? Barclays Center generally has no specific age restriction for most concerts, meaning it is typically an all-ages venue. However, this can sometimes vary based on the specific artist or promoter. For Summer Walker's show, it is expected to be an all-ages event. Attendees should bring valid photo ID, especially if purchasing alcoholic beverages.

Photography and video policies? Generally, personal, non-professional cameras and mobile phones are permitted for still photography. However, video recording and flash photography are typically prohibited. Large professional cameras with detachable lenses are also not allowed. It's always best to check Barclays Center's specific policy closer to the event date, as these can sometimes change.

Bag and item restrictions? Barclays Center enforces strict bag policies. Small clutch purses (no larger than 6" x 8") are permitted. Clear plastic bags (no larger than 12" x 6" x 12") are also allowed. Backpacks, duffel bags, and large handbags are prohibited. Additionally, prohibited items include outside food and beverages, weapons, and professional recording equipment.

What's the refund policy? Refund policies are typically determined by the ticket vendor (e.g., Ticketmaster). Generally, tickets are non-refundable unless the event is cancelled by the artist or venue. In case of cancellation, refunds are usually issued to the original purchaser. Rescheduling of an event usually means tickets remain valid for the new date.

Parking situation near Barclays Center? Barclays Center has an on-site parking garage accessible from Atlantic Avenue. However, this facility is limited in capacity and can be quite expensive. Additional parking garages are available in the surrounding areas, but street parking is extremely scarce and heavily regulated. Relying on public transportation is strongly recommended for ease and cost-effectiveness.

How early should I arrive? Given the size of Barclays Center and the popularity of Summer Walker, it is highly recommended to arrive at least 1.5 to 2 hours before the scheduled start time. This allows ample time for security screenings, navigating the venue, finding your seats, and potentially grabbing a drink or merchandise without feeling rushed.

ATMs and payment options? ATMs are available inside Barclays Center for your convenience. Most concessions and merchandise stands accept major credit and debit cards. However, it's always a good idea to have some cash on hand for smaller purchases or if you encounter a vendor that is cash-only.
